Output 31db4897495bc05c26b7f3dc4ef63d1771b2c067731e33511fac87237dc80eea:1

value
105401816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b4872cdda66c264aca03a3302102274d9da23d2 OP_EQUAL
address
35dsmbiBLYcb5Rv91gLSYMy2UCqCtHHAwd
transaction
31db4897495bc05c26b7f3dc4ef63d1771b2c067731e33511fac87237dc80eea
spent
true